I have tried the current GRUB on a PowerMac G4 running Fedora 8.

If I follow the instructions at http://grub.enbug.org/TestingOnPowerPC, I cannot load grubof.modules. If I do it directly from openfirmware, I get "CLAIM failed" message.

I tried adding grubof.modules to the OS selection menu in ofboot.b script installed by yaboot, so that grubof.modules is loaded like yaboot. That doesn't work either. In some cases, I would get the openfirmware prompt, in other cases, the menu would restart. It looks like the attempt to load grubof.modules makes openfirmware unstable.

I also tried loading kernel.elf created by the build process. It loads and shows the prompt. However, GRUB starts in the rescue mode, and I cannot do anything in that mode.
